No Outside or Inside Pockets — Food Safe by Design
The defining hygiene feature of the Portwest Baker's Shirt is its completely pocketless construction. In food handling environments, pockets present a genuine contamination risk. Loose items stored in pockets — pens, notes, personal belongings — can fall into food during preparation. More insidiously, pockets trap flour dust, food debris, and bacteria in their seams and corners, creating hidden reservoirs of contamination that are difficult to eliminate even with thorough washing.
By removing all pockets — both external and internal — the 2209 baker's shirt eliminates these risks entirely. The smooth, unbroken fabric surfaces are easy to clean, quick to dry, and leave nowhere for contaminants to accumulate. This pocketless design supports compliance with food safety management systems such as HACCP (Hazard Analysis and Critical Control Points) and helps businesses demonstrate due diligence in their approach to food hygiene.

Food Industry Workwear — Why Compliance Matters
In the United Kingdom, businesses involved in food production, preparation, and handling are subject to a comprehensive framework of food safety legislation. The Food Safety Act 1990, the Food Hygiene (England) Regulations 2013 (and equivalent regulations in Scotland, Wales, and Northern Ireland), and European-derived food hygiene standards all place obligations on food businesses to maintain high standards of cleanliness and prevent contamination of food products.
Workwear plays a critical role in meeting these obligations. The Food Standards Agency (FSA) guidance states that people who work in food handling areas must wear suitable, clean, and where necessary protective clothing. Workwear for food handlers should be light-coloured (white is the standard for bakeries and many food production environments) so that contamination is easily visible, free from external pockets that could harbour contaminants, machine washable at temperatures sufficient to destroy bacteria, and maintained in a clean condition throughout the working shift.
The Portwest 2209 Baker's Shirt is designed to meet all of these requirements. Its pocketless construction, 60°C washability, and durable, professional-looking Kingsmill fabric make it an ideal choice for food businesses that need to demonstrate compliance with UK food safety regulations and the principles of HACCP-based food safety management systems.

Caring for Your Portwest Baker's Shirt
To get the best performance and longest life from your Portwest 2209 Baker's Shirt, follow these care guidelines. Machine wash at 60°C using a standard commercial or domestic detergent. Avoid using bleach unless specifically required by your food safety protocols, as repeated bleaching can weaken the fabric over time. Tumble dry on a medium heat setting or line dry. The polycotton fabric dries relatively quickly compared to pure cotton, reducing turnaround time between washes. Iron on a medium setting if required, although the polyester content means the fabric is naturally resistant to creasing and many wearers find ironing is unnecessary. Do not dry clean.
For businesses operating industrial laundry facilities, the 2209 is compatible with standard commercial wash processes at 60°C and will maintain its appearance and integrity through repeated industrial wash cycles.
